Objective: To study the clinical efficacy, recurrence rate and safety of 5-aminolevulinic acid-based photodynamic therapy (ALA-PDT) combined with microneedle or CO2 lattice laser (CO2FL), in comparison with intrascar betamethasone injection in the treatment of hypertrophic acne scar.
Methods: Fifty-two patients with hypertrophic acne scars at the mandibular angle were enrolled and assigned to different therapy groups. Sixteen patients were treated with microneedle-assisted incorporation of ALA.
Background: Keratosis pilaris is a hereditary abnormal keratosis of the hair follicle orifice. Gray-brown keratotic plugs in the pores and dark red keratotic papules at the openings of hair follicles can be seen, which contain coiled hair and are often accompanied by perifollicular erythema and pigmentation. Glycolic acid can correct the abnormalities of hair follicular duct keratosis and eliminate excessive accumulation of keratinocytes.
